package com.baeldung.dockerapi;
import com.github.dockerjava.api.DockerClient;
import com.github.dockerjava.api.command.InspectImageResponse;
import com.github.dockerjava.api.model.Image;
import com.github.dockerjava.api.model.SearchItem;
import com.github.dockerjava.core.DockerClientBuilder;
import com.github.dockerjava.core.command.BuildImageResultCallback;
import com.github.dockerjava.core.command.PullImageResultCallback;
import com.github.dockerjava.core.command.PushImageResultCallback;
import org.junit.BeforeClass;
import org.junit.Test;
import java.io.File;
import java.util.List;
import java.util.concurrent.TimeUnit;
import static org.hamcrest.MatcherAssert.assertThat;
import static org.hamcrest.Matchers.greaterThan;
import static org.hamcrest.Matchers.lessThan;
import static org.hamcrest.Matchers.not;
import static org.hamcrest.core.Is.is;
public class ImageLiveTest {
private static DockerClient dockerClient;
@BeforeClass
public static void setup() {
dockerClient = DockerClientBuilder.getInstance().build();
}
@Test
public void whenListingImages_thenReturnNonEmptyList() {
//when
List<Image> images = dockerClient.listImagesCmd().exec();
//then
assertThat(images.size(), is(not(0)));
}
@Test
public void whenListingImagesWithIntermediateImages_thenReturnNonEmptyList() {
//when
List<Image> images = dockerClient.listImagesCmd()
.withShowAll(true).exec();
//then
assertThat(images.size(), is(not(0)));
}
@Test
public void whenListingDanglingImages_thenReturnNonNullList() {
//when
List<Image> images = dockerClient.listImagesCmd()
.withDanglingFilter(true).exec();
//then
assertThat(images, is(not(null)));
}
@Test
public void whenBuildingImage_thenMustReturnImageId() {
//when
String imageId = dockerClient.buildImageCmd()
.withDockerfile(new File("src/test/resources/dockerapi/Dockerfile"))
.withPull(true)
.withNoCache(true)
.withTag("alpine:git")
.exec(new BuildImageResultCallback())
.awaitImageId();
//then
assertThat(imageId, is(not(null)));
}
@Test
public void givenListOfImages_whenInspectImage_thenMustReturnObject() {
//given
List<Image> images = dockerClient.listImagesCmd().exec();
Image image = images.get(0);
//when
InspectImageResponse imageResponse
= dockerClient.inspectImageCmd(image.getId()).exec();
//then
assertThat(imageResponse.getId(), is(image.getId()));
}
@Test
public void givenListOfImages_whenTagImage_thenListMustIncrement() {
//given
List<Image> images = dockerClient.listImagesCmd().exec();
Image image = images.get(0);
//when
dockerClient.tagImageCmd(image.getId(), "baeldung/alpine", "3.6.v2").exec();
//then
List<Image> imagesNow = dockerClient.listImagesCmd().exec();
assertThat(imagesNow.size(), is(greaterThan(images.size())));
}
public void pushingAnImage() throws InterruptedException {
dockerClient.pushImageCmd("baeldung/alpine")
.withTag("3.6.v2")
.exec(new PushImageResultCallback())
.awaitCompletion(90, TimeUnit.SECONDS);
}
@Test
public void whenPullingImage_thenImageListNotEmpty() throws InterruptedException {
//when
dockerClient.pullImageCmd("alpine")
.withTag("latest")
.exec(new PullImageResultCallback())
.awaitCompletion(30, TimeUnit.SECONDS);
//then
List<Image> images = dockerClient.listImagesCmd().exec();
assertThat(images.size(), is(not(0)));
}
@Test
public void whenRemovingImage_thenImageListDecrease() {
//when
List<Image> images = dockerClient.listImagesCmd().exec();
Image image = images.get(0);
dockerClient.removeImageCmd(image.getId()).exec();
//then
List<Image> imagesNow = dockerClient.listImagesCmd().exec();
assertThat(imagesNow.size(), is(lessThan(images.size())));
}
@Test
public void whenSearchingImage_thenMustReturn25Items() {
//when
List<SearchItem> items = dockerClient.searchImagesCmd("Java").exec();
//then
assertThat(items.size(), is(25));
}
}
